best answer: can you pre cook bacon?
Pre-cooking bacon is a convenient way to save time and effort during busy mornings or for meal prep. Here are a few reasons why you might want to pre-cook bacon:
* Convenience: Pre-cooked bacon can be quickly reheated and enjoyed as needed. It’s perfect for those who are short on time or who want to have bacon on hand for quick and easy meals.
* Time savings: Pre-cooking bacon saves time on busy mornings. You can cook a large batch of bacon in advance and then store it in the refrigerator or freezer for later use.
* Meal prep: Pre-cooked bacon can be incorporated into various meal prep recipes. You can add it to salads, sandwiches, wraps, and casseroles. It’s a versatile ingredient that can be used in place of fresh bacon to save time and effort.
* Storage: Pre-cooked bacon can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days or in the freezer for up to 2 months. This makes it easy to have bacon on hand for quick and easy meals throughout the week.

can i prebake bacon?
You can prebake bacon in the oven for a crispy, time-saving snack.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and lay the bacon strips flat. Bake at 400°F for 15-20 minutes, or until the bacon is cooked to your desired crispness. Let the bacon cool before storing it in an airtight container. To reheat, simply microwave the bacon for a few seconds until warmed through.

how do you reheat cooked bacon?
You can reheat cooked bacon in a variety of ways. If you’re short on time, you can microwave it. Place the bacon on a paper towel-lined plate and microwave it on high for 15-30 seconds, or until it’s warmed through. However, the microwave can make the bacon tough, so it’s best to reheat it in the oven or on the stovetop if you can. To reheat bacon in the oven, preheat the o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it. Place the bacon on a sheet pan and bake it for 10-15 minutes, or until it’s warmed through. To reheat bacon on the stovetop, heat a skillet over medium heat. Add the bacon and cook it for 3-5 minutes per side, or until it’s warmed through. Once the bacon is reheated, enjoy it as a side dish, a topping for a salad or sandwich, or as a snack.
does fully cooked bacon need to be refrigerated before opening?
Fully cooked bacon, whether in an unopened or opened package, should be refrigerated to maintain its quality and prevent spoilage. Refrigeration helps slow down the growth of bacteria and mold, which can cause the bacon to become unsafe to consume. Unopened packages of fully cooked bacon can typically last for several weeks in the refrigerator, while opened packages should be consumed within a week or two. To ensure the best quality and flavor, it’s important to keep fully cooked bacon refrigerated before and after opening.
how do you make bacon crispy?
Preheat your o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Lay the bacon strips on the prepared baking sheet in a single layer. Bake the bacon for 15-20 minutes, or until it is crispy and browned to your liking. Remove the bacon from the oven and let it cool on a paper towel-lined plate before serving. Tips: Use thick-sliced bacon for best results. Flip the bacon halfway through cooking to ensure even cooking. Keep an eye on the bacon while it is cooking to prevent it from burning. To make the bacon even crispier, you can cook it in a single layer on a wire rack placed over a baking sheet. This will allow the bacon to cook evenly on all sides. Once the bacon is cooked, you can store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days.

why is my bacon not crispy?
If your bacon is not crispy, there are several possible reasons. The thickness of the bacon can affect how crispy it gets. Thicker bacon will take longer to cook and may not get as crispy as thinner bacon. The temperature of the pan is also important. If the pan is not hot enough, the bacon will not crisp up. It’s also important to not overcrowd the pan, as this will prevent the bacon from getting crispy. Finally, make sure to cook the bacon long enough. If you cook it too quickly, it will not have a chance to crisp up.
